• If all solvents are of a similar polarity, it is recommended
that the solvent be primed in order of decreasing solvent
strength, with the weakest solvent primed last.
• If the 4 solvents are of mixed polarity (aqueous and
nonpolar), ensure that sequential solvents are
compatible, such as water, acetonitrile, ethyl acetate,
hexane.
• If you are performing an auto prime after redefining
some of the solvents, it may be beneficial to run 2
auto prime operations sequentially to get full flushing
of the lines.

After Auto Priming, the system is ready for operation. If you are
priming a new system for the first time, it may be beneficial to
flush all of the fluid lines with the desired solvent to remove any
isopropanol left from production testing.
